Marcel Siem, a professional golfer from Germany, has competed in various majors in his career but has never played in the Masters at Augusta National Golf Club. Siem thought he had qualified for the Masters in 2013 after winning the Trophée Hassan II in Morocco, which boosted his World Ranking into the projected top 50. However, a late surge from Henrik Stenson at the Shell Houston Open knocked Siem out of the top 50, leaving him just outside of qualifying for the prestigious tournament. Marco Penge recently found himself in hot water after being sanctioned by the DP World Tour for breaching betting rules. The English golfer was fined £2,000 and banned for three months, with one of those months suspended, after it was found that he had placed bets on multiple golf events. Penge has since admitted to making an “honest mistake” and is adamant that he will never repeat this error. The PNC Championship is a unique golf tournament that features only 20 players who have won a Major, seniors Major, or The Players Championship, along with their family members as amateur partners. Formerly known as the Father-Son Challenge, the tournament has seen the likes of Tiger Woods playing with his son Charlie and John Daly with his son ‘Little John’.
